**Job title** Kitchen Assistant Reporting to Chef

Main Purpose

Assists with the operation of a catering service within a Healthcare Ireland unit with particular emphasis on the movement, storage and preparation of food within the unit.

**Key Accountabilities**

**_ Quality_**

1. Ensures that all catering stock and equipment is correctly stored and accounted for in accordance with the company’s Assured Safe Catering standards.

2. Delivers meals and other catering supplies to various areas within the unit in a timely and efficient manner.

3. Under direction, assists with the basic preparation of food items.

4. Ensures all cleaning within the kitchen, catering and servery areas (as appropriate) is completed in a timely and efficient manner and complies with the company’s Assured Safe Catering standards.

5. Delivers and maintains a clean and tidy environment throughout the home, in line with operational standards and ensures that work processes comply with statutory regulations.

**_ Innovation_**

6. Implements new services or more effective methods developed by management into their line of work.

**_ Value_**

7. Ensures service users are receiving a service that is value for their money.

Knowledge & Skills The role holder requires basic numeracy and literacy together with an appreciation of basic food hygiene a professional cooking qualification is required for Assistant Chef.

Experience NVQ Level II Hospitality&Catering(preferably) butTraining will be provided.

Autonomy & Impact The role holder undertakes routine and regular tasks with some discretion to prioritise work.

Intelligent Problem Solving All problem solving is routine and there are a pre-defined range of solutions.

Responsibility Staff Occasionally required to assist less experienced colleagues.

Budgets & equipment No budgetary or financial responsibility.Responsible for the appropriate use of various pieces of catering equipment.

Informatics Shared responsibility for maintaining appropriate records and data as required under the company’s Assured Safe Catering policies and guidelines.

Communication & Interaction Regularly responds to routine enquiries from colleagues and occasionally from patients, pupils or students.

Working environment The role holder works within a busy kitchen environment using a variety of equipment where many routine tasks are repetitive and require a degree of sustained physical effort and concentration.
